SubjectRe: [PATCH 1/2] Add C99-style constructor macros for specific-sized integers
DateMon, 3 Mar 2008 04:20:37 +0100
> Although it is fully legal and correct C to write something like:
>
> (u64)0x123456789abcdef
>
> .. gcc will issue a warning on 32-bit systems that 0x123456789abcdef
> is too big for an "int", and that it has been transparently promoted,
> even though it is obvious that that is what the user intended in the
> first place.

[It says it is too big for 'long', actually].

That's because this is not valid ISO C90. GCC tries to help you out
by using the C99 rules (it has to do something, and terminating with
an error would be a bit rude). Perhaps the kernel should use C99
mode (-std=gnu99, to get the GNU C extensions).

> +#define S8_C(x) x
> +#define U8_C(x) x ## U
> +#define S16_C(x) x
> +#define U16_C(x) x ## U
> +#define S32_C(x) x
> +#define U32_C(x) x ## U

These are unnecessary, Linux requires an int to be at least 32 bits.

> +#define S64_C(x) x ## LL
> +#define U64_C(x) x ## ULL

Here you can use LL resp. ULL on all archs.


Do these new macros really buy anything over just writing LL in the
few places that 64-bit constants are used?
